My twitters got a virus, how do i reset it?
my twitter has a virus and is sending direct messages to people that are virus's it always tweets virus's, how do i reset my twitter?

Twitter is a web based service. It is unlikely to have a virus, and it can't send a virus through a line of text.

Most likely your computer is infected though. Run a virus scan on your computer, while disconnected from the internet. There's several decent, free anti-virus programs out there. Best to run at least 2 tests with different programs.
